- Tonbo:
Website: http://tonboimaging.com/india/
Founder and CEO: Arvind Lakshmikumar is the founder and CEO of Tonbo.
About the startup: Tonbo designs advanced night-vision imaging systems for Para military forces so that its military vehicles can see clearly and navigate during night time, in foggy conditions, in dusty and smoky conditions and during times of heavy rain and snowfall. These night-vision imaging systems can be custom fitted to any military vehicle be it a military tank or a transport vehicle or a UAV or a helicopter or a fighter plane. The startup was founded in 2012 and is looking to expand globally by the end of 2018.
- Uniphore:
Website: https://www.uniphore.com/
Co-founder and CEO: Umesh Sachdev is the co-founder and CEO of Uniphore
About the startup: Uniphore Software Systems is a Chennai-based Speech Recognition software company that makes human interaction with software seamless and effortless by deploying software which accurately recognise human speech. Its speech recognition software has features like Speech Analytics, Virtual Assistant and Voice Biometrics to make human interaction with software easy and accurate.

- Unbxd:
Website: https://unbxd.com/
Co-founders: Unbxd was founded in 2011 by Sondur and Prashant Kumar.
About the startup: If you are a merchant, trying to sell your product/s online through any e-commerce platform like Amazon, Flipkart, Myntra, etcetera but are not quite able to do so due to poor product discovery offered by e-commerce platforms, there’s good news for you. Unbxd is an e-commerce product discovery platform/software that deploys advanced data sciences to connect shoppers to the products they are most likely to buy. The software has features like intelligent site search, personalized product recommendations and real-time merchandising insights which will make your product discovery on e-commerce websites faster and easier. The software even has a chat-interface which enables you to chat with online merchants or the startup’s core team to get the product and brand you desire. A few e-commerce platforms around the world have embedded Unbxd software in their websites.

- TempoGo:
Website: https://www.tempogo.com/
Founder: Pranav Shirke
About the startup: TempoGo manufactures IoT based sensors that can be fitted on transport vehicles to monitor the vehicle’s location (using a GPS – based hardware unit in the sensor), the vehicle’s speed, the vehicle’s fuel consumption and it can also be used to monitor the temperature in refrigeration trucks. In short, all aspects of a transport vehicle’s behaviour can be monitored using TempoGo’s sensors. The startup has raised crores of rupees through investments and is looking forward to a PAN-India expansion next year (2018).
